How to Prepare your home for an inspection
16/05/2024 Duración: 15minIn this episode, Brian and Tony discuss tips for homeowners to get their homes ready for a home inspection when selling. They cover the importance of providing clear access to key areas like the electrical panel, water heater, attic, and sewer clean-outs. The hosts explain how obstructed access can lead to incomplete inspections and additional costs for hiring specialists.They emphasize clearing out clutter, especially in the garage, and ensuring inspectors can easily locate shut-off valves, sprinkler controls, and other essential components. Brian and Tony also recommend being present for the first part of the inspection to answer questions, provide notes about the home's systems, or simply ensure pets don't get out.While major renovations aren't necessary, they advise addressing minor issues like missing outlet covers to streamline the inspection process. Overall, the episode guides sellers on properly preparing their home to facilitate a smooth, comprehensive inspection.

Is Being A Real Estate Agent Dangerous?
26/09/2022 Duración: 10minThe House Fluent Podcast is back. We are going to kick off the infamous return with a short interview for Realtor Safety Month. Bill Mueller is a veteran of the martial arts and self defense community with over 45 years of experience training and teaching others. He is also a licensed Real Estate Agent in the DFW area and has decided to combine his talents to help others.With surprising statistics on the rise when it comes to how at risk Real Estate Agents really are. According to the "2020 National Association of Realtors, Realtor Safety Report" (https://cdn.nar.realtor/sites/default/files/documents/2020-member-safety-report-08-31-2020.pdf) , 31 percent of REALTORS® reported feeling unsafe during an open house and showings. 27 percent felt unsafe while meeting a new client for the first time at a secluded location/property. Do I need a Sewer Camera Inspection?
22/04/2021 Duración: 20minEver wonder if there is an alligator in your sewer? Sewer camera inspections reveal that and so much more. The main sewer line between your home and street is generally the responsibility of you as a home owner. It is one of the most neglected things in a home. It's buried, under constant bombardment from nature and impossible to see inside of without special equipment. Your main sewer line is also one of the most expensive items to repair in a home. On this show, we talk about what a sewer camera inspection can accomplish as well as some of the limitations. We also talk about when and how often it makes sense to get an inspection.
